++++++ 0011-Fix-ldap-host-lookup-ipv6.patch ++++++
The patch was written by Christian Kornacker on 2014-01-08 to fix an issue with 
unresponsive
LDAP host lookups in IPv6 environment.

---
 libraries/libldap/util-int.c |   43 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++--
 1 file changed, 41 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

Index: openldap-2.3.37/libraries/libldap/util-int.c
===================================================================
--- openldap-2.3.37.orig/libraries/libldap/util-int.c
+++ openldap-2.3.37/libraries/libldap/util-int.c
@@ -527,10 +527,16 @@ static char *safe_realloc( char **buf, i
 
 char * ldap_pvt_get_fqdn( char *name )
 {
-       char *fqdn, *ha_buf;
+       int rc;
+       char *fqdn;
        char hostbuf[MAXHOSTNAMELEN+1];
+#ifdef HAVE_GETADDRINFO
+       struct addrinfo hints, *res;
+#else
+       char *ha_buf;
        struct hostent *hp, he_buf;
-       int rc, local_h_errno;
+       int local_h_errno;
+#endif
 
        if( name == NULL ) {
                if( gethostname( hostbuf, MAXHOSTNAMELEN ) == 0 ) {
@@ -541,6 +547,37 @@ char * ldap_pvt_get_fqdn( char *name )
                }
        }
 
+#ifdef HAVE_GETADDRINFO
+       memset( &hints, '\0', sizeof( hints ) );
+       hints.ai_family = AF_UNSPEC;
+       hints.ai_socktype = SOCK_STREAM;
+       hints.ai_flags |= AI_CANONNAME;
+
+       /* most getaddrinfo(3) use non-threadsafe resolver libraries */
+#if defined( LDAP_R_COMPILE )
+       ldap_pvt_thread_mutex_lock(&ldap_int_resolv_mutex);
+#endif
+
+       rc = getaddrinfo( name, NULL, &hints, &res );
+
+#if defined( LDAP_R_COMPILE )
+       ldap_pvt_thread_mutex_unlock(&ldap_int_resolv_mutex);
+#endif
+
+       if ( rc != 0 ) {
+               fqdn = LDAP_STRDUP( name );
+       } else {
+               while ( res ) {
+                       if ( res->ai_canonname ) {
+                               fqdn = LDAP_STRDUP ( res->ai_canonname );
+                               break;
+                       }
+                       res = res->ai_next;
+               }
+               freeaddrinfo( res );
+       }
+#else
+
        rc = ldap_pvt_gethostbyname_a( name,
                &he_buf, &ha_buf, &hp, &local_h_errno );
 
@@ -551,6 +588,8 @@ char * ldap_pvt_get_fqdn( char *name )
        }
 
        LDAP_FREE( ha_buf );
+#endif
+
        return fqdn;
 }
